KTKP records the origin species as Schizonepeta tenuifolia (Benth.) Briq.. It has not yet been cross-checked against the Korean Pharmacopoeia, so the identification confidence is not raised to an official code mapping. The same drug appears under 6 records as name variants. The same source species also yields 2 other separately registered drug(s) (Schizonepetae Folium, Schizonepetae Herba), which must not be conflated. The name most used for this taxon in current literature is Schizonepeta tenuifolia. Literature searches for this herb also cover Nepeta tenuifolia — the same taxon appears under several names.

The KTKP traditional materia medica record (M0004232) gives the origin species as Schizonepeta tenuifolia (Benth.) Briq., the part used as 꽃대, and the properties as 무독(無毒), 신(辛), 온(溫). It lists 간(肝), 폐(肺) as the channels entered. The same record cites the Donguibogam (1613) as the source for its indications.

Properties & channel entry: 무독(無毒), 신(辛), 온(溫) · 간(肝), 폐(肺)

Source species: Schizonepeta tenuifolia (Benth.) Briq. (꽃대)
